import type { Span, Trace } from '../../types';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* `Accessors` is necessary because `ScrollManager` needs to be created by | ||
* `TracePage` so it can be passed into the keyboard shortcut manager. But, | ||
* `ScrollManager` needs to know about the state of `ListView` and `Positions`, | ||
* which are very low-level. And, storing their state info in redux or | ||
* `TracePage#state` would be inefficient because the state info only rarely | ||
* needs to be accessed (when a keyboard shortcut is triggered). `Accessors` | ||
* allows that state info to be accessed in a loosely coupled fashion on an | ||
* as-needed basis. | ||
*/ | ||
export type Accessors = { | ||
getViewRange: () => [number, number], | ||
getSearchedSpanIDs: () => ?Set<string>, | ||
getCollapsedChildren: () => ?Set<string>, | ||
getViewHeight: () => number, | ||
getBottomRowIndexVisible: () => number, | ||
getTopRowIndexVisible: () => number, | ||
getRowPosition: number => { height: number, y: number }, | ||
mapRowIndexToSpanIndex: number => number, | ||
mapSpanIndexToRowIndex: number => number, | ||
}; | ||
|
||
interface Scroller { | ||
scrollTo: number => void, | ||
scrollBy: (number, ?boolean) => void, |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Returns `{ isHidden: true, ... }` if one of the parents of `span` is | ||
* collapsed, e.g. has children hidden. | ||
* | ||
* @param {Span} span The Span to check for. | ||
* @param {Set<string>} childrenAreHidden The set of Spans known to have hidden | ||
* children, either because it is | ||
* collapsed or has a collapsed parent. | ||
* @param {Map<string, ?Span} spansMap Mapping from spanID to Span. | ||
* @returns {{ isHidden: boolean, parentIds: Set<string> }} | ||
*/ | ||
function isSpanHidden(span: Span, childrenAreHidden: Set<string>, spansMap: Map<string, ?Span>) { | ||
const parentIDs = new Set(); | ||
let { references } = span; | ||
let parentID: ?string; | ||
const checkRef = ref => { | ||
if (ref.refType === 'CHILD_OF') { | ||
parentID = ref.spanID; | ||
parentIDs.add(parentID); | ||
return childrenAreHidden.has(parentID); | ||
} | ||
return false; | ||
}; | ||
while (Array.isArray(references) && references.length) { | ||
const isHidden = references.some(checkRef); | ||
if (isHidden) { | ||
return { isHidden, parentIDs }; | ||
} | ||
if (!parentID) { | ||
break; | ||
} | ||
const parent = spansMap.get(parentID); | ||
parentID = undefined; | ||
references = parent && parent.references; | ||
} | ||
return { parentIDs, isHidden: false }; | ||
} | ||

/** | ||
* ScrollManager is intended for scrolling the TracePage. Has two modes, paging | ||
* and scrolling to the previous or next visible span. | ||
*/ | ||
export default class ScrollManager { | ||
_trace: ?Trace; | ||
_scroller: Scroller; | ||
_accessors: ?Accessors; | ||
|
||
constructor(trace: ?Trace, scroller: Scroller) { | ||
this._trace = trace; | ||
this._scroller = scroller; | ||
this._accessors = undefined; | ||
} | ||
|
||
_scrollPast(rowIndex: number, direction: 1 | -1) { | ||
const xrs = this._accessors; | ||
if (!xrs) { | ||
throw new Error('Accessors not set'); | ||
} | ||
const isUp = direction < 0; | ||
const position = xrs.getRowPosition(rowIndex); | ||
if (!position) { | ||
console.warn('Invalid row index'); | ||
return; | ||
} | ||
let { y } = position; | ||
const vh = xrs.getViewHeight(); | ||
if (!isUp) { | ||
y += position.height; | ||
// scrollTop is based on the top of the window | ||
y -= vh; | ||
} | ||
y += direction * 0.5 * vh; | ||
this._scroller.scrollTo(y); | ||
} | ||
|
||
_scrollToVisibleSpan(direction: 1 | -1) { | ||
const xrs = this._accessors; | ||
if (!xrs) { | ||
throw new Error('Accessors not set'); | ||
} | ||
if (!this._trace) { | ||
return; | ||
} | ||
const { duration, spans, startTime: traceStartTime } = this._trace; | ||
const isUp = direction < 0; | ||
const boundaryRow = isUp ? xrs.getTopRowIndexVisible() : xrs.getBottomRowIndexVisible(); | ||
const spanIndex = xrs.mapRowIndexToSpanIndex(boundaryRow); | ||
if ((spanIndex === 0 && isUp) || (spanIndex === spans.length - 1 && !isUp)) { | ||
return; | ||
} | ||
// fullViewSpanIndex is one row inside the view window unless already at the top or bottom | ||
let fullViewSpanIndex = spanIndex; | ||
if (spanIndex !== 0 && spanIndex !== spans.length - 1) { | ||
fullViewSpanIndex -= direction; | ||
} | ||
const [viewStart, viewEnd] = xrs.getViewRange(); | ||
const checkVisibility = viewStart !== 0 || viewEnd !== 1; | ||
// use NaN as fallback to make flow happy | ||
const startTime = checkVisibility ? traceStartTime + duration * viewStart : NaN; | ||
const endTime = checkVisibility ? traceStartTime + duration * viewEnd : NaN; | ||
const findMatches = xrs.getSearchedSpanIDs(); | ||
const _collapsed = xrs.getCollapsedChildren(); | ||
const childrenAreHidden = _collapsed ? new Set(_collapsed) : null; | ||
// use empty Map as fallback to make flow happy | ||
const spansMap = childrenAreHidden ? new Map(spans.map(s => [s.spanID, s])) : new Map(); | ||
const boundary = direction < 0 ? -1 : spans.length; | ||
let nextSpanIndex: number; | ||
for (let i = fullViewSpanIndex + direction; i !== boundary; i += direction) { | ||
const span = spans[i]; | ||
const { duration: spanDuration, spanID, startTime: spanStartTime } = span; | ||
const spanEndTime = spanStartTime + spanDuration; | ||
if (checkVisibility && (spanStartTime > endTime || spanEndTime < startTime)) { | ||
// span is not visible within the view range | ||
continue; | ||
} | ||
if (findMatches && !findMatches.has(spanID)) { | ||
// skip to search matches (when searching) | ||
continue; | ||
} | ||
if (childrenAreHidden) { | ||
// make sure the span is not collapsed | ||
const { isHidden, parentIDs } = isSpanHidden(span, childrenAreHidden, spansMap); | ||
if (isHidden) { | ||
childrenAreHidden.add(...parentIDs); | ||
continue; | ||
} | ||
} | ||
nextSpanIndex = i; | ||
break; | ||
} | ||
if (!nextSpanIndex || nextSpanIndex === boundary) { | ||
// might as well scroll to the top or bottom | ||
nextSpanIndex = boundary - direction; | ||
} | ||
const nextRow = xrs.mapSpanIndexToRowIndex(nextSpanIndex); | ||
this._scrollPast(nextRow, direction); |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Sometimes the ScrollManager is created before the trace is loaded. This | ||
* setter allows the trace to be set asynchronously. | ||
*/ | ||
setTrace(trace: ?Trace) { | ||
this._trace = trace; |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* `setAccessors` is bound in the ctor, so it can be passed as a prop to | ||
* children components. | ||
*/ | ||
setAccessors = (accessors: Accessors) => { | ||
this._accessors = accessors; | ||
};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Scrolls around one page down (0.95x). It is bounds in the ctor, so it can | ||
* be used as a keyboard shortcut handler. | ||
*/ | ||
scrollPageDown = () => { | ||
if (!this._scroller || !this._accessors) { | ||
return; | ||
} | ||
this._scroller.scrollBy(0.95 * this._accessors.getViewHeight(), true); | ||
};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Scrolls around one page up (0.95x). It is bounds in the ctor, so it can | ||
* be used as a keyboard shortcut handler. | ||
*/ | ||
scrollPageUp = () => { | ||
if (!this._scroller || !this._accessors) { | ||
return; | ||
} | ||
this._scroller.scrollBy(-0.95 * this._accessors.getViewHeight(), true); | ||
};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Scrolls to the next visible span, ignoring spans that do not match the | ||
* text filter, if there is one. It is bounds in the ctor, so it can | ||
* be used as a keyboard shortcut handler. | ||
*/ | ||
scrollToNextVisibleSpan = () => { | ||
this._scrollToVisibleSpan(1); | ||
};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Scrolls to the previous visible span, ignoring spans that do not match the | ||
* text filter, if there is one. It is bounds in the ctor, so it can | ||
* be used as a keyboard shortcut handler. | ||
*/ | ||
scrollToPrevVisibleSpan = () => { | ||
this._scrollToVisibleSpan(-1); | ||
}; | ||
|
||
destroy() { | ||
this._trace = undefined; | ||
this._scroller = (undefined: any); | ||
this._accessors = undefined; | ||
} | ||
} |
